Why Choose UPVC?
Before we check out the information about installers, let's briefly think about why UPVC is an excellent financial investment for your home:
| Benefit | Description |
|---|---|
| Resilience | Resistant to weathering, deterioration, and fading. |
| Energy Efficiency | Outstanding insulation residential or commercial properties cause lower energy costs. |
| Aesthetic Appeal | Readily available in numerous designs and colors for modification. |
| Low Maintenance | Needs minimal upkeep compared to wood or metal frames. |

The Installation Process
Understanding what to anticipate during the installation procedure can assist alleviate concerns for property owners. Here's a detailed breakdown:
1. Preliminary Consultation
During the initial consultation, the installer will assess your needs and choices, take measurements, and go over products and designs. This is a fun time to ask questions and clarify doubts.
2. Preparation
As soon as you devote to the installation, the group will prepare your home. This includes eliminating old doors or windows, making adjustments if essential, and ensuring the area is safe and clean.
3. Installation
The real installation process usually takes one to two days, depending upon the job's scale. The team will:
- Install new frames and sashes.
- Connect the UPVC doors and windows firmly.
- Make sure proper sealing to prevent drafts and water ingress.
4. Finishing Touches
After installation, any gaps will be filled, and finishing touches like trims will be used. The installers will make sure the brand-new doors and windows operate appropriately and are lined up.
5. Final Inspection
Before leaving your properties, the installers carry out a last examination. They will inspect for any concerns, guarantee everything is working properly, and tidy up the area, leaving your home tidy.
UPVC Maintenance Tips
Once your UPVC windows and doors have been installed, maintaining them will ensure their longevity. Here are some fast ideas:
- Regular Cleaning: Clean the frames with a soft fabric and warm soapy water.
- Check Sealing: Periodically inspect weather condition seals for wear and tear.
- Oil Moving Parts: Use silicone spray on hinges and locks yearly for smooth operation.
- Inspect for Damage: Regularly look for any indications of damage or wear.
Frequently Asked Questions
Q1: How long do UPVC doors and windows last?
A1: With appropriate installation and maintenance, UPVC doors and windows can last approximately 30 years or more.
Q2: Are UPVC windows and doors energy efficient?
A2: Yes, UPVC products offer outstanding insulation residential or commercial properties that can significantly lower heating and cooling costs.
Q3: Can UPVC windows be painted?
A3: While UPVC Door And Window Installers can technically be painted, it is not advised as it can affect the product's homes and may void warranties.
Q4: What is the cost of UPVC installation?
A4: Costs can differ extensively based on factors like size, kind of door or window, and location. Usually, property owners can anticipate to pay in between ₤ 400 and ₤ 1,200 per unit set up.

Q5: What colors are readily available for UPVC windows and doors?
A5: UPVC doors and windows are readily available in numerous colors, consisting of standard white, cream, and woodgrain results. Custom-made colors might also be available depending upon the maker.
